Provider overview
Hales Corners Lutheran Church offers Buddy Break, a free monthly respite program for families of children and young adults with special needs in Hales Corners.
Hales Corners Lutheran Church offers special-needs ministry including the Buddy Break monthly respite program and inclusive faith formation support.

Program details we found
Buddy Break monthly respite
Hales Corners Lutheran Church hosts Buddy Break, a free monthly respite program for families of kids and young adults with special needs, offered Sunday afternoons in the Fellowship Hall, with one-on-one volunteer Buddies and activity rooms for music, games, crafts, gym, and STEM.
